AmgelEscape - Amgel Easy Room Escape 73 is another point and click escape game developed by Amgel Escape. In this game, you are locked in a room and you have to try to escape the room by finding items and solving puzzles. Show your best escaping skills to escape from the room. Can you able to escape from the room successfully? Good luck and have fun!
Blast The Color!
Pet Doctor Animal Care
Backrooms: Skibidi Shooter
Brick Game 3D
Pick And Match Game
Archers.io
Traffic Go
Undead Mahjong
Raccoon Retail
Morgan Super 3 Puzzle
Roof Rail Online
Insect Pic Puzzles
The Specimen Zero
Merge Master - Army Commander
Parking Game - BE A PARKER 2
Happy Candy
Brick Break
Sweet Girl Summer Camp
Zipline Rescue Little Jerry
basketball only beasts
Fall Race 3D Game
Face Paint Jigsaw
Infinite Brick Breaker
Elsa College Couples
Yatzy Yams
Pop It Fidget : Anti Stress
Nitro Nation: Car Racing Game
Drive Mad Master
Sneak In 3D
Stack Ball - Blast through platforms